Romski Čačak

History

A Balkan Rom dance. I learnt this from Michael Ginsburg in 1998.

Rhythm

The music has an even, 4/4 rhythm.

Steps

Start in a line, arms in a V hold, facing to the right.

Touch in front with the right foot, then step onto it. Repeat with the left, then again with the right.

Turn to face centre and step across behind with the left foot.

Turn to face left and step back with the right foot.

Repeat all of this to the left, starting with the left foot, but end up facing centre.

Cross the right foot in front.

Replace the left in place.

Cross the right foot behind the left.

Turn to face right and step forward with the left.
